

Dennis Kevin Dunn, age 73, of Tucker, Georgia passed away on Wednesday, October 26, 2022. He was born in St. Louis on September 30, 1949 to Joseph and Teresa Dunn. Dennis was a proud veteran of the U.S. Coast Guard. He was preceded in death by his parents and his wife of 48 years, Karen. Dennis was a very kind man. He had a gentle soul and would do whatever he could for anyone. He loved his family and his friends. He was a very active member of his church Saint John the Wonderworker, where he made many good friends and did a lot for the community. Dennis did work with the homeless as well as working in the penitentiary system where he helped to reform convicted felons and prepare them for their release back into the community. Dennis was the kind of man who would give a homeless man or woman all the money in his wallet and the shirt off of his back. That is how good he was! Just a quiet Samaritan. When Karen passed away in August, Dennis was lost without her. He and Bailey, his beloved companion, would spend evenings on his back deck missing her and if he was by himself calling his family and friends. He ultimately was wishing he was talking to Karen. Dennis took great pride in his military service and his time in the Coast Guard and always had a funny story to tell about his antics and absolutely his shenanigans. His three siblings were often the subject of his stories, some may say they might not have all been exactly 100% true, but that is what made them as funny as they were! Dennis liked to joke around a lot but he had a heart full of love. He will be dearly missed by all. May God bless Dennis and may he Rest In Peace. Dennis is survived by his brothers, Jim (Theresa) Dunn of McDonough and Joe Dunn of Panama City, FL and one sister Sherry Woodworth (Sam Sellers) of Murrells Inlet, SC and several nieces, nephews, grand nieces and grand nephews. A Celebration of Life will be held at 10:30am on Wednesday, November 2, 2022 at Haisten Funeral Home in McDonough, GA. Burial will follow at Georgia Veterans Memorial Cemetery in Milledgeville, GA.
